Designing dynamic lighting systems for the Maldivian market presents unique engineering challenges. The highly saline, humid, and warm tropical climate accelerates corrosion on standard architectural fixtures. Therefore, our marine-grade, dynamic lighting solutions are specifically treated with marine-grade anti-corrosive powder coatings, IP65/IP67 waterproof seals, and robust internal thermal management. This ensures that the dynamic spatial effects remain pristine and reliable over years of continuous tropical exposure.

Why Dynamic Lighting Matters to Hospitality Procurement Officers

Globally, project owners, MEP (Mechanical, Electrical, Plumbing) consultants, and spatial designers look for specific performance characteristics in their lighting suppliers:

  • Thermal Control Systems: Thermal dissipation is the primary factor limiting the lifespan of high-output LEDs. Using cold-forged 6063 aluminum heat sinks prevents lumen depreciation in tropical environments.
  • Digital Dimming Curves: Seamless transitions require high-resolution (16-bit) dimming to eliminate flickering at low illumination levels, a critical feature for high-definition photography and luxury interior spaces.
  • System Interoperability: Architectural lighting must interface smoothly with centralized control networks (such as Crestron, Lutron, or Madrix), allowing for seamless pre-programmed scene switches.

Engineering FAQ: Dynamic Lighting Systems for the Maldivian Market

How do your fixtures handle the high-salinity marine air of the Maldives?
Our dynamic lighting fixtures designed for coastal regions feature housings constructed from high-tensile, copper-free die-cast aluminum (A380 or ADC12 grade). They are finished with a specialized marine-grade, double-layer thermosetting powder coating that prevents salt spray corrosion. All external screws are made of marine-grade 316 stainless steel, and our gaskets use high-durability fluorosilicone to prevent moisture intrusion.
Can your corridor lighting integrate directly with pre-existing hotel PMS or Crestron systems?
Yes. All our dynamic DMX512 controllers and driver assemblies support standard protocol integration. They interface directly with centralized automation networks (including Crestron, Lutron, Control4, and Helvar) using DMX-to-IP gateways or dry-contact triggers. This allows the lights to adjust automatically based on resort occupancy, scheduling, or atmospheric music states.
